
Worked extensively on the grafana/opentelemetry-ebpf-instrumentation repository, delivering features that enhanced observability, reliability, and performance for eBPF-based telemetry. Focused on backend development using Go and C, the work included dynamic eBPF program loading, runtime-configurable map sizing, and expanded TCP metrics for improved network visibility. Addressed kernel compatibility, implemented robust configuration validation, and introduced batching and retry mechanisms to increase deployment stability. Code quality was improved through targeted refactoring, documentation cleanup, and expanded test coverage. The approach emphasized maintainability, safer configurations, and efficient resource usage, resulting in a more robust, scalable, and diagnosable instrumentation platform for cloud-native environments.
May 2026 monthly summary for grafana/opentelemetry-ebpf-instrumentation focused on optimizing resource usage, expanding observability, and stabilizing CI. Delivered dynamic eBPF program loading, expanded TCP metrics, and CI fixes with broad documentation coverage.
May 2026 monthly summary for grafana/opentelemetry-ebpf-instrumentation focused on optimizing resource usage, expanding observability, and stabilizing CI. Delivered dynamic eBPF program loading, expanded TCP metrics, and CI fixes with broad documentation coverage.
April 2026 delivered scalable observability enhancements and platform safety for the OpenTelemetry eBPF instrumentation project. Key work includes runtime-configurable eBPF map sizing and span batching (BatchMaxSize/QueueSize), expanded metrics for service and network visibility, and OS compatibility validations. Fixed race conditions in netolly, improved error handling, updated tests and configs, and minor documentation cleanup. These changes increase monitoring fidelity, reduce false positives, and enable safer deployments at scale across environments.
April 2026 delivered scalable observability enhancements and platform safety for the OpenTelemetry eBPF instrumentation project. Key work includes runtime-configurable eBPF map sizing and span batching (BatchMaxSize/QueueSize), expanded metrics for service and network visibility, and OS compatibility validations. Fixed race conditions in netolly, improved error handling, updated tests and configs, and minor documentation cleanup. These changes increase monitoring fidelity, reduce false positives, and enable safer deployments at scale across environments.
March 2026 — Grafana/opentelemetry-ebpf-instrumentation: Delivered reliability, performance, and observability improvements with configurable retries, retry-related config-schema updates, standardized ebpf map loading, and enhanced instrumentation. Implemented targeted refactors to improve maintainability and prepare for expanded usage across Netolly/StatSolly workloads. Addressed kernel-specific compatibility issues to reduce runtime failures across environments. The month emphasizes business value through reduced downtime, higher data fidelity, and stronger validation/test coverage.
March 2026 — Grafana/opentelemetry-ebpf-instrumentation: Delivered reliability, performance, and observability improvements with configurable retries, retry-related config-schema updates, standardized ebpf map loading, and enhanced instrumentation. Implemented targeted refactors to improve maintainability and prepare for expanded usage across Netolly/StatSolly workloads. Addressed kernel-specific compatibility issues to reduce runtime failures across environments. The month emphasizes business value through reduced downtime, higher data fidelity, and stronger validation/test coverage.
February 2026 monthly summary for grafana/opentelemetry-ebpf-instrumentation. Delivered feature enhancement and targeted code quality improvements that strengthen reliability, performance, and maintainability of the OpenTelemetry eBPF instrumentation. The month focused on improving event receive reliability, code safety, and maintainability through careful refactors and diagnostics enhancements.
February 2026 monthly summary for grafana/opentelemetry-ebpf-instrumentation. Delivered feature enhancement and targeted code quality improvements that strengthen reliability, performance, and maintainability of the OpenTelemetry eBPF instrumentation. The month focused on improving event receive reliability, code safety, and maintainability through careful refactors and diagnostics enhancements.
January 2026 — focused on elevating observability, reliability, and performance in eBPF-based instrumentation and Kafka protocol handling. Achievements include: (1) Standardized and enhanced debug/log output across eBPF/BPF instrumentation for better traceability and debugging efficiency; (2) Kafka large message buffer support enabling handling of larger messages and improved throughput; (3) Build and Documentation Reliability improvements across architectures with absolute-path documentation to reduce onboarding friction and build failures; (4) Code cleanup for eBPF instrumentation removing unused headers and functions to reduce maintenance burden; (5) Bug fixes including clarifying ProcessCudaEvent return value and correcting eBPF attribute typos for correctness and readability. Impact: Faster troubleshooting, more robust data pipelines, fewer build issues, and easier maintenance across both Go and C instrumentation layers. Demonstrates strong capabilities in low-level instrumentation (eBPF/C), Kafka protocol handling, cross-architecture build processes, and clean code practices that reduce risk and accelerate delivery.
January 2026 — focused on elevating observability, reliability, and performance in eBPF-based instrumentation and Kafka protocol handling. Achievements include: (1) Standardized and enhanced debug/log output across eBPF/BPF instrumentation for better traceability and debugging efficiency; (2) Kafka large message buffer support enabling handling of larger messages and improved throughput; (3) Build and Documentation Reliability improvements across architectures with absolute-path documentation to reduce onboarding friction and build failures; (4) Code cleanup for eBPF instrumentation removing unused headers and functions to reduce maintenance burden; (5) Bug fixes including clarifying ProcessCudaEvent return value and correcting eBPF attribute typos for correctness and readability. Impact: Faster troubleshooting, more robust data pipelines, fewer build issues, and easier maintenance across both Go and C instrumentation layers. Demonstrates strong capabilities in low-level instrumentation (eBPF/C), Kafka protocol handling, cross-architecture build processes, and clean code practices that reduce risk and accelerate delivery.
Month: 2025-12 — Focused on improving observability, reliability, and configuration handling in grafana/opentelemetry-ebpf-instrumentation. Delivered enhanced configuration name resolution, unified eBPF debug logging, and corrected error messages to reduce confusion. These changes improve deployment stability, diagnosability, and time-to-resolution for configuration issues, reinforcing the platform's robustness in production.
Month: 2025-12 — Focused on improving observability, reliability, and configuration handling in grafana/opentelemetry-ebpf-instrumentation. Delivered enhanced configuration name resolution, unified eBPF debug logging, and corrected error messages to reduce confusion. These changes improve deployment stability, diagnosability, and time-to-resolution for configuration issues, reinforcing the platform's robustness in production.
November 2025 — Grafana Opentelemetry EBPF instrumentation: Delivered batch operation support for Elasticsearch, added OpenSearch compatibility, and completed documentation and internal refactors to improve maintainability and cross-system reliability. The release enhances performance, expands deployment options, and strengthens code quality with broader test coverage and clearer type definitions.
November 2025 — Grafana Opentelemetry EBPF instrumentation: Delivered batch operation support for Elasticsearch, added OpenSearch compatibility, and completed documentation and internal refactors to improve maintainability and cross-system reliability. The release enhances performance, expands deployment options, and strengthens code quality with broader test coverage and clearer type definitions.
Monthly summary for 2025-10: Focused improvements in the grafana/opentelemetry-ebpf-instrumentation repo delivering configuration validation enhancements and comprehensive documentation cleanup. No runtime behavior changes were introduced this month; changes center on correctness, developer experience, and maintainability, with explicit emphasis on safer configurations and clearer docs.
Monthly summary for 2025-10: Focused improvements in the grafana/opentelemetry-ebpf-instrumentation repo delivering configuration validation enhancements and comprehensive documentation cleanup. No runtime behavior changes were introduced this month; changes center on correctness, developer experience, and maintainability, with explicit emphasis on safer configurations and clearer docs.

Overview of all repositories you've contributed to across your timeline